lachine
proper noun
/ləˈʃiːn/

Definition
A term that can refer to a specific area, typically associated with the Lachine borough in Montreal, Canada, known for its cultural and historical significance.

Examples
- Many tourists visit Lachine for its beautiful waterfront parks.
- The Lachine Canal was crucial for trade in the 19th century.
- Lachine is renowned for its rich history and vibrant community events.

Meaning
Lachine relates to the historical region and its developments, particularly in relation to water routes and fur trade.
